Community (Feral) Cat Resources

A step-by-step guide on how to preform TNR in your neighborhood

October 14, 2019 by Friends For Life

“Community cat” is an umbrella definition that includes any un-owned cat.

These cats may be “feral” (un-socialized) or friendly ones that may have been born into the wild or may be lost or abandoned pet cats. They typically live in colonies.

Feral cats have no wish to live indoors as pets. When brought into a traditional shelter, these cats are euthanized to make space for adoptable cats, however, our mission at Friends For Life is to TNR (Trap, Neuter/Spay, and Return) these cats so that the feral colony is stable and no new cats are being born.
